How they compare
Indonesia currently reports 34 against 33.76 in Dominican Republic, a difference of 0.24.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 16 shared years of data; in 1996 it was Indonesia ahead.
Dominican Republic ranks 91st and Indonesia ranks 88th of 104 countries.
Indonesia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Dominican Republic | Indonesia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 30.21 | 33.3 | 3.09 | Indonesia |
| 2000s | 32.54 | 34.23 | 1.69 | Indonesia |
| 2010s | 33.87 | 33.91 | 0.0435 | Indonesia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
